summaryrefslogtreecommitdiff
path: root/src/transport/plugin_transport_http_server.c
AgeCommit message (Expand)Author
2019-01-28improve NAT API: allow client to store associated data with addressChristian Grothoff
2019-01-14src: for every AGPL3.0 file, add SPDX identifier.ng0
2018-11-23rename fest: use new libgnunetnt instead of old libgnunetats logic for networ...Christian Grothoff
2018-06-07paragraph for gnunet devs that don't know how to use the webpsyc://loupsycedyglgamf.onion/~lynX
2018-06-07glitch in the license text detected by hyazinthe, thank you!psyc://loupsycedyglgamf.onion/~lynX
2018-06-05first batch of license fixes (boring)psyc://loupsycedyglgamf.onion/~lynX
2017-10-29allow MST callback to distinguish between disconnect and parse error situatio...Christian Grothoff
2017-06-25[transport] Fix EBADF in select()David Barksdale
2017-06-15[transport] copy-paste error, nothing to see hereDavid Barksdale
2017-06-15[transport] Don't exit with suspended connectionsDavid Barksdale
2017-06-12[transport] suspend connection to avoid busy-waitDavid Barksdale
2017-03-17more renamings relating to 'new' service now just being the 'normal' serviceChristian Grothoff
2017-03-16removing dead/legacy server/connection logic, except for in tcp/wlan/bt plugi...Christian Grothoff
2017-01-07migrate HTTP plugin to new NAT logicChristian Grothoff
2016-10-12revert to MHD_USE_SSL for nowChristian Grothoff
2016-10-11deprecate USE_SSL for USE_TLS, rename in codeChristian Grothoff
2016-07-24-fix http fixChristian Grothoff
2016-07-24fix http server shutdown sequenceChristian Grothoff
2016-07-08-avoid calling memcpy() with NULL argument, even if len is 0Christian Grothoff
2016-07-06misc minor fixesChristian Grothoff
2016-04-30implementing new scheduler shutdown semanticsChristian Grothoff
2016-04-09small API change: do no longer pass rarely needed GNUNET_SCHEDULER_TaskContex...Christian Grothoff
2016-01-19-fix (C) noticesChristian Grothoff
2015-10-18rename 'struct Session' to 'struct GNUNET_ATS_Session' to satisfy naming conv...Christian Grothoff
2015-10-07determine network scope for ATS even if we do not yet have a session and only...Christian Grothoff
2015-07-18Get STUN to work with UDP pluginBruno Cabral
2015-07-18minor modifications to reduce warningsChristian Grothoff
2015-06-30fix #3869: outdated FSF addressChristian Grothoff
2015-06-12fix use of deprecated MHD symbolsChristian Grothoff
2015-02-23Don't timeout XHR clients so quickly.David Barksdale
2015-02-10fixing #3657 (replace ATS_Information with struct), but WIHTOUT fixing ATS te...Christian Grothoff
2015-02-07-bringing copyright tags up to FSF standardChristian Grothoff
2015-02-05Various changes:Christian Grothoff
2015-01-17simplify ATS API and plugin API by returning the network type, instead of an ...Christian Grothoff
2014-12-24making GNUNET_SCHEDULER_cancel() perform in O(1) instead of O(n) to help or e...Christian Grothoff
2014-12-23-fix call to MHD_start_daemon, properly pass MHD_USE_IPv6 if neededChristian Grothoff
2014-11-22-rename constantsChristian Grothoff
2014-11-22-fix warningChristian Grothoff
2014-11-22adding TCP STEALTH support (without integrity protection) to HTTP(S) serverChristian Grothoff
2014-11-07implementing plugin session monitoring API (#3452)Christian Grothoff
2014-07-24- fix compileBart Polot
2014-07-24fixing documentationMatthias Wachs
2014-07-09fixing USE_SUSPEND error with mhd daemon and free errorMatthias Wachs
2014-07-03Require libmicrohttpd >= 0.9.32David Barksdale
2014-07-03Use MHD_USE_SUSPEND_RESUME, fixes #3460David Barksdale
2014-07-03Don't break, this is expected from XHR clientsDavid Barksdale
2014-07-03- fixing use after freeMatthias Wachs
2014-07-03fixing memory leak and session disconnectMatthias Wachs
2014-07-02Simplify HTTP server session cleanup even moreDavid Barksdale
2014-06-27do not notify transport multiple time for a sessionMatthias Wachs